Understanding the Core Mechanics of Crazy Time
At its heart, Crazy Time is a money wheel game with a live presenter. The wheel is divided into several segments, each corresponding to a different multiplier or bonus game. Players place bets on the segments they believe the wheel will land on. The primary segments include numbers (1, 2, 5, and 10) with corresponding multipliers, and four exciting bonus games: Cash Hunt, Coin Flip, Crazy Time, and Wheel of Fortune. The volatility of the game largely stems from these bonus rounds, which offer the potential for massive payouts, but also carry a degree of unpredictability.
The betting process is relatively straightforward. Before each spin, players have a short window to place their bets on any of the available segments. The Role of the Live Presenter
The live presenter is an integral part of the Crazy Time experience. They not only spin the wheel but also facilitate the bonus games, adding a layer of social interaction and excitement to the gameplay. The presenter’s energy and engagement contribute significantly to the overall atmosphere. Beyond the entertainment value, the presenter interacts with the players in the chat, creating a sense of community. Skilled presenters are adept at maintaining a fast pace while clearly explaining the rules and procedures of each bonus game, keeping players informed and engaged throughout the session.
The presenter’s performance is also crucial during the bonus rounds. For example, in the Cash Hunt, the presenter directs a moving target across a wall of potential multipliers, requiring quick reflexes and accuracy. In the Crazy Time bonus, the presenter spins a second wheel, potentially awarding multipliers from 2x to 20x. The presenter’s ability to manage these rounds efficiently and fairly is essential for maintaining player trust and enjoyment.

Developing a Bankroll Management Strategy
Effective bankroll management is paramount when playing Crazy Time, or any casino game for that matter. It's easy to get caught up in the excitement and chase losses, but a disciplined approach is critical for long-term success. A common strategy involves setting a specific budget for your Crazy Time sessions and sticking to it, regardless of whether you're winning or losing. Determining your bet size is also crucial. A general rule of thumb is to b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each spin—typically between 1% and 5%. This helps to minimize your risk and allows you to withstand losing streaks.
Furthermore, it's important to set win and loss limits. If you reach your win limit, it’s a good idea to cash out and walk away. Likewise, if you reach your loss limit, it’s equally important to stop playing and avoid chasing your losses. This prevents you from making impulsive decisions and potentially losing your entire bankroll. Utilizing the Martingale and Anti-Martingale Systems
Two popular betting systems often discussed in the context of Crazy Time are the Martingale and Anti-Martingale strategies. The Martingale system invol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the goal of recovering your losses and making a small profit when you eventually win. However, this system can be risky, as it requires a large bankroll to sustain a prolonged losing streak. The Anti-Martingale system, conversely, involves increasing your bet after each win and decreasing it after each loss. This approach is less risky than the Martingale system, but it may result in smaller profits.
It is important to note that neither of these systems guarantees success. They are simply betting strategies, and the outcome of each spin remains random. While these systems can be helpful in managing your bets and potentially increasing your profits, they should be used with caution and within the context of a well-defined bankroll management plan. The Psychological Aspects of Playing Crazy Time
Crazy Time, like many casino games, can be highly stimulating and engaging. The fast-paced action, vibrant visuals, and charismatic live presenter create an immersive experience that can be both exciting and addictive. It’s important to be aware of the psychological factors that can influence your decision-making while playing the game. One common pitfall is the “gambler’s fallacy,” the belief that past results can somehow influence future outcomes. This can lead players to chase losses or make irrational bets based on perceived patterns.
Another psychological factor to be mindful of is the “near miss” effect. When you almost win, but fall just short, it can trigger a release of dopamine in the brain, creating a sense of excitement and encouraging you to continue playing. This effect can be particularly strong in Crazy Time, as the bonus rounds often involve multiple stages and near misses. It’s crucial to recognize these psychological biases and avoid letting them cloud your judgment. Maintaining a clear and rational mindset is essential for making sound betting decisions.
